Output f5415b4c05bfcb1a68c929a6e6b21db86cf90918f28362b09e7d48e0f398b656:17

value
145000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d6a5318aa5abef6db6dd9aee794dc976bba39d4 OP_EQUAL
address
3MskdVzU14DAFNzomRhMo3y2xxyJ8mzLaX
transaction
f5415b4c05bfcb1a68c929a6e6b21db86cf90918f28362b09e7d48e0f398b656
confirmations
302232
spent
true